Reynolds Park

Reynolds Park is a beautiful 14 acre Green Flag park set within the Woolton conservation area of South Liverpool.

Facilities and attractions

A place to enjoy passive recreation and contemplation you can also enjoy features such as:

  • A walled garden with herbaceous borders and beautiful Dahlia displays. 
  • Woodland areas and Rhododendron lined footpaths.
  • A wildflower meadow.
  • A quarry (closed to the public but available for biological research).
  • A sunken garden.
  • A Topiary garden.
  • A Ha-ha.
  • Lawns used for picnics and family entertainment.
  • Natural play area.

Opening hours

The park is open 24 hours a day all year round. The walled garden is open from 10am to 5.45pm April to September and until 3.45 during October to March. The walled garden is closed on bank holidays.

How to get there

Main access is located on Church Road, L25. Other entrances are from Woolton Hill Road and Woolton Park.
